Empecamenta methneri
Species of beetle
From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Empecamenta methneri is a species of beetle of the family Scarabaeidae.[1] It is found in eastern Africa.[2][3]

Description
Adults reach a length of about 9 mm. They have an oblong-oval, chestnut-brown, shiny body. They are densely covered with tawny hairs. The antennae are reddish-yellow.[3]
